Understanding Sound Isolation
Before diving into treatment strategies, it’s important to understand what sound isolation entails. Sound isolation refers to the ability to prevent sound from entering or leaving a space. For percussion instruments, which can be particularly loud, effective isolation can make a significant difference in sound quality.

Use of Bass Traps
Bass traps are essential for controlling low-frequency sounds that percussion instruments often produce. These traps absorb sound waves and prevent them from bouncing around the room, which can create muddiness in recordings. Place bass traps in corners where low frequencies tend to build up.
Installing Acoustic Panels
Acoustic panels are designed to absorb mid to high-frequency sounds. Installing these panels on walls can greatly reduce echo and reverberation, allowing for clearer sound capture. Focus on areas where sound waves are likely to reflect, such as opposite walls and ceilings.
Sealing Gaps and Cracks
Even small gaps and cracks can allow sound to leak in or out of a room. Inspect your space for any openings, particularly around doors, windows, and electrical outlets. Use weather stripping, caulk, or acoustic sealant to effectively seal these gaps.
Utilizing Diffusers
Diffusers help to scatter sound waves rather than absorb them, preventing the buildup of sound in one area. This is particularly useful for percussion instruments, which can produce sharp, transient sounds. Place diffusers strategically around the room to enhance sound quality without deadening the acoustics.
Creating a Soundproof Room
If possible, consider creating a dedicated soundproof room for your percussion practice or recording. This can involve adding soundproofing materials to walls, floors, and ceilings, as well as using double doors and specialized soundproof windows. While this may require a larger investment, the payoff in sound quality can be substantial.

Use Rugs or Carpets
Hard floors can reflect sound waves, leading to an undesirable acoustic environment. Adding rugs or carpets can help absorb sound and reduce reflections, creating a warmer sound in the room.
Place Heavy Furniture Against Walls
Heavy furniture can act as a barrier to sound waves. By positioning bookshelves, sofas, or other large items against walls, you can help block sound from escaping or entering the space.
Invest in Isolation Pads for Drums
Isolation pads are designed to absorb vibrations from drums, preventing them from transferring to the floor and causing noise in adjacent rooms. This simple addition can greatly enhance sound isolation for percussion setups.
High-Quality Microphones
Using microphones specifically designed for percussion can help capture the true sound of your instruments while minimizing background noise. Look for dynamic or condenser microphones that are well-suited for high SPL (sound pressure level) environments.
